What to Know
The Cole Camp Fair is a compact three-day September event in the small Benton County community of Cole Camp, a town with deep German heritage in the rolling hills of west-central Missouri. The fair has long been a gathering point for rural families across the Osage River region.
On the Midway
Visitors will find livestock shows, 4-H competitions, local exhibits, fair food, and community entertainment in a three-day format that captures the essence of the traditional Missouri country fair.
